WWE’s Liv Morgan to make film debut in ‘The Kill Room’

WWE star Liv Morgan has booked her first film role.

It was announced via Deadline today that Morgan (real name Gionna Daddio) will make her big-screen acting debut in “The Kill Room.” The film is described as being a darkly comic thriller.

Morgan will play “an art purist who bemoans the vapidness of art dealers.”

Uma Thurman, Samuel L. Jackson, Joe Manganiello, Maya Hawke, Debi Mazar, Larry Pine, Dree Hemingway, and Leah McSweeney are also part of the cast for “The Kill Room.”

“The film centers on hitman Reggie (Manganiello), his boss (Jackson), an art dealer (Thurman) and their money laundering scheme that accidentally turns the hitman into an overnight Avant-Garde sensation, forcing the dealer to play the art world against the underworld,” Deadline wrote.

Nicol Paone is the director of “The Kill Room.” A release date for the film has yet to be announced.

Yale Entertainment is producing “The Kill Room.”

In WWE, Morgan is currently feuding with her former tag team partner Rhea Ripley. Morgan, AJ Styles & Finn Balor will face The Judgment Day (Ripley, Edge & Damian Priest) in a six-person mixed tag team match at Hell in a Cell this Sunday.
